About Telecommunications and Broadcast Law in Topeka, United States:

Telecommunications and broadcast law in Topeka, United States encompass regulations and policies that govern the telecommunications and broadcasting industries. These laws aim to ensure fair competition, protect consumer rights, and maintain the integrity of communication networks.

Local Laws Overview:

In Topeka, key aspects of local laws relevant to telecommunications and broadcast include zoning regulations for telecommunications infrastructure, licensing requirements for broadcasters, consumer protection laws related to telecommunication services, and competition policies in the telecommunications market. It is essential to be aware of these laws to ensure compliance and avoid legal conflicts.

Frequently Asked Questions:

Q: What licenses are required to operate a broadcasting station in Topeka?

A: Broadcasting stations in Topeka are required to obtain licenses from the Federal Communications Commission (FCC) to operate legally.

Q: Can I file a complaint against my telecommunications provider for poor service?

A: Yes, you can file a complaint with the Kansas Corporation Commission, which regulates telecommunication services in Topeka, if you are dissatisfied with your provider's service.

Q: Are there specific regulations for the placement of cell towers in Topeka?

A: Yes, Topeka has zoning regulations that dictate where cell towers can be located to minimize their impact on the community and environment.
